The Novato Flood Protection and Watershed Program is a collaborative effort of the County of Marin, Marin County Flood Control and Water Conservation District Zone No. 1– Novato, City of Novato, North Marin Water District, and Novato Sanitary District.

Its goal is to provide a framework to integrate flood protection and en- vironmental restoration with public and private partners to protect and enhance Marin’s watersheds.

Novato Watershed Program Overview Novato has a history of flooding. Winter storms in 2016-2017 closed Highway 37 for 27 days and flooded neighborhood streets. Adding to historic issues, the City now faces new threats of sea level rise and climate change. Flood Control Zone 1, charged with flood protection, has funding to maintain its current facilities but little for new capital projects. The goal of the Novato Watershed Program was to understand and evaluate options for the future.

The core of the Novato Watershed Program is its partnership with local agencies. The Program partnered with Marin County, City of Novato, Novato Sanitary District, North Marin Water District, and the Flood Con- trol Zone No. 1 (Zone 1) Advisory Board to jointly finance, scope, and review the Program’s work products. In addition, work was supported by three stakeholder committees: Policy Advisory Committee (PAC), Technical Work Group (TWG), and Operations and Finance Committee. These partnerships and committees were cru- cial to the Program’s community focus.

The primary work product was a watershed-wide unified hydrology and hydraulic model. The 2016 Hydraulic Study, which modeled hydrology and hydraulics of the entire Novato Creek watershed, was designed to pro- vide a system-wide analysis of options to integrate flood protection goals and sediment management efforts

Novato Watershed Program Supports Watershed Characteristics City Planning and Sustainability Efforts The Novato Creek watershed is the largest watershed in eastern Marin County, encompassing a 45 square mile drainage extending eastward from Big Rock Ridge, Stafford Lake, and Mt. Burdell across suburban valleys, and through an expansive leveed intertidal bay- land to San Pablo Bay. The watershed is approximately 17 miles long with elevations ranging from approximately 1900 ft. at ridge tops to sea level at San Pablo Bay. It is bordered by coastal hills to the west, the basin and San Pablo Bay to the north- east and east, and the Miller Creek watershed to the southeast. Stafford Lake, with a storage capacity of 4,450 acre ft., is a water supply reservoir operated by North Marin Water District, and it sep- arates the upper 8.3 square miles of headwaters (5 miles of creek) from the lower drainage. Ten tributaries join the main stem of No- vato Creek as it traverses the watershed below Stafford Dam.

History of Floods and Flood Protection Activities Novato is prone to flooding due to its topography and development patterns. In some locations in the upper watershed, Novato Creek is severely constrained by bedrock and the steep slopes of knolls and hillsides. Dur- ing high flow events, the creek overflows and sends stormwater down local streets. Farther down the water- shed, the land flattens. The creeks here tend to flow more slowly and deposit sediment, which can impede flow during winter storms.

In the past 90 years, Novato has experienced 12 major floods, averaging over one per decade. Floods in 1940, 1955, 1982, 1998, and 2006 were particularly destructive. The impacts of flooding affect residents, business- es, property owners, emergency response, transportation networks, and the overall economic vitality of the community. Levees were breached intentionally in 2006, 2008, and 2014 to protect downtown and residen- tial neighborhoods. Highway 37 was closed for 27 days in winter 2017 due to flooding.

However, the Novato community also has a legacy of progressive leadership in proposing and implementing solutions. The County, the City of Novato, and the Zone 1 Advisory Board have a long history of implementing successful flood protection projects.

July 2017 6 Novato Flood Protection and Watershed Program

In 1972, the Flood Control District acquired 1200 acres in the lower baylands (the area behind Vintage Oaks Shopping Center). These lands had been slated for the development of 6500 homes in the floodplain; now, these lands are used for flood storage and are available for flood protection, tidal marsh restoration, sea lev- el rise adaptation projects, and water re-use.

Following the severe flooding in 1982, Novato residents passed a $20 million benefit assessment, which in- cluded a 4-yr assessment for capital project construction and a modest operations and maintenance assess- ment that continues to this day. The capital projects were encapsulated into the Novato Flood Control Pro- ject, which comprised eight phases of work focused on maximizing flood conveyance and stabilizing eroding banks in Novato and Warner Creeks between Grant Ave. and Diablo Ave. It also included raising Stafford Dam to increase storage and the installation of a high flow diversion structure at Arroyo Avichi. Construction of the eight phases took place from 1985-2006.

Zone 1 owns and maintains 5 miles of levees and four stormwater pump stations. Every four years, Zone 1 removes accumulated sediment from 1.5 miles of Arroyo Avichi and Novato and Warner Creeks between Dia- blo Ave. and the Sonoma Marin Area Rail Transit (SMART) Bridge to maintain flow conveyance through this low-lying reach. In addition, annual channel maintenance in Novato Creek and its tributaries includes trim- ming of downed trees and vegetation and trash removal, and as-needed stabilization of failing banks on Zone -owned parcels along 15 miles of creeks.

The 2016 Hydraulic Study considered these flood reduction efforts in light of current and future needs, and evaluated opportunities in the baylands and in the upper watershed to further improve the level of flood protection and begin adaptation to climate change and sea level rise.

Climate Change and Sea Level Rise Impacts in Novato Our climate is changing. Average global temperatures have increased by 1.4° F over the past 100 years. Much of this heat is absorbed by the world’s oceans. As global average temperatures rise, the water in the ocean warms, expands, and elevates sea levels. In San Francisco Bay, sea levels have risen seven inches over the past century. These rising sea levels:  increase the upstream extent of tidal flooding  worsen creek flooding due to backwater effects of elevated high tides  create larger, stronger waves that erode the shoreline and destroy sensitive marshes Climate change is also likely to increase the magnitude and frequency of winter storms, further worsening flooding problems.

In Novato, we can expect water surface elevations in the baylands to increase from 1-3 feet within the next 50 years. The higher tides will put additional pressure on creek discharge to the bay and are likely to increase flood durations. Floodwaters may need several tide cycles to recede. Transportation networks are especially vulnerable, including Highways 101 and 37 and Redwood Blvd. and Rowland Blvd. which are important com- mercial areas that contribute to tax base of the City.

Flood Control 2.0 - Nature-based Solutions to Reduce Flooding As the modeling work progressed, the lower Novato Creek baylands was chosen as one of three focus areas, along with near Palo Alto and lower Walnut Creek, for Flood Control 2.0, an ambitious regional effort funded by the U.S. Environmental Protection Agency and the San Francisco Bay Water Quality Improvement Fund and undertaken by scientists from the San Francisco Estuary Institute.

Flood Control 2.0 seeks to re-direct flood protection strategies from more traditional hard engineering solu- tions to those that work with natural processes. The project aims to increase flood protection while restoring stream and wetland habitats, improving water quality, and adapting to sea level rise around San Francisco Bay. Through an interdisciplinary team linking regional science expertise with on-the-ground flood control agencies, the project advances channel redesign to restore wetland habitat, water quality, and shoreline re- silience through demonstration projects.

Concepts from Flood Control 2.0 work products, including the Novato Creek Baylands Historical Ecology Study and Novato Creek Baylands Vision, have been incorporated into the development of potential projects. Participation in Flood Control 2.0 has also provided information about the Novato Watershed Program to a regional audience of scientists and grant funding agencies.

The hydraulic study showed that smaller projects in the upper watershed failed to sufficiently reduce flood- ing downstream due to the immense drainage area to Novato Creek. The many improvements constructed through the prior work of the Novato Flood Control Project maximized channel capacity and conveyance of storm flows. Therefore, the project concepts focus on opening up the Baylands owned by the Marin County Flood Control District and the State of California, down- stream of the Highway 101 crossing of Novato Creek. This is the area behind the Vintage Oaks Shopping Center and downstream of Highway 37 near the community of Bel Marin Keys.

A keystone project concept is the Deer Island Basin Tidal Marsh restoration. This concept embodies all of the main Novato Watershed Program themes: restoration of 100 acres of diked baylands to tidal marsh, flood reduction from lowered water surface elevations, utilizing natural processes to move sediment downstream, adaptation to sea level rise with horizontal levees, local sediment re- NORTH DEER ISLAND BASIN (SOUTH OF SLADE PARK) use, and enhanced recreation via a new levee trail.

Status of Funding Neither local agencies nor Program partners have sufficient funding to complete the identified potential pro- jects. Therefore, a funding measure of some type would be required to raise revenue to fund projects and to leverage State and Federal grant funds. The Novato Watershed Program is investigating a potential revenue measure in 2017 or later.

While the Novato Watershed Program is well-positioned to aggressively pursue grant funds for project imple- mentation, it is important to note that grants typically require the grantee to “match” the grant amounts. For any given project, a grantor may contribute anywhere from 25-50% of costs. Therefore, in order to leverage grants, the grantee must have available local funds for the unmatched amounts. Grant Funding Leveraging state and federal grant funding is key to constructing the projects identified by the Novato Water- shed Program. The Program has been successful in attracting attention from regional and national planners, engineers and scientists, which has contributed to the Program’s success in securing grant awards. The Pro- gram has been awarded over $2.2 million in grants for flood protection projects in the Novato watershed since the Watershed Program was initiated. To date, Zone 1 and the Novato Watershed Program have been able to provide the needed match funding for these grants. However, additional Zone 1 funds will be needed to match future grants.
